英文摘要
DESCRIPTION: (Verbatim) - The etiology of osteoarthritis (OA) is at present
unknown. Genetic, environmental, metabolic, and biomechanical factors have been
suggested as playing possible roles. Interest in a genetic role for the
etiology of OA has expanded based on clinical identification of positive
inheritance patterns in certain disease subsets such as Heberden's nodes,
differences in the prevalence of OA among different races and populations, and
the demonstration of type II collagen gene (COL2A1) mutations as a cause of
primary generalized OA. Evidence suggests mutations in loci other than COL2A1
may be important in familial OA as well. Our studies have demonstrated multiple
loci of COL2A1 mutations (Arg519-Cys, Arg75-Cys) associated with familial OA
and, based on founder studies, identified susceptibility sites ("hot-spots") of
mutation. In addition, our serum marker studies have demonstrated an imbalance
between matrix degradation and synthesis in mutation-positive, OA-positive
individuals. The studies proposed in our further series of investigations will:
Aim 1) locate and identify collagen and/or non-collagen matrix-associated genes
which are associated with primary OA utilizing the over 35 families already
available; investigational approaches include candidate gene screening;
high-throughput linkage analysis of the human genome using highly polymorphic
markers; and analysis of complex traits using data derived from genome
screening in combination with computerized modeling and simulation methods; and
Aim 2) expand our study of serum markers to further define pathophysiologic
mechanisms and clinical utility in OA utilizing new multiple large kindreds now
available. Studies based on individuals with genetic mutations destined to
develop OA at a defined age (2nd to 3rd decades) allow a unique, otherwise
unavailable opportunity for correlative marker assessments. The overall
proposal will further insights into genetically related OA, and
pathophysiologic mechanisms.
